Cone of Confusion is a genre-defying multicultural project based in Sydney, Australia that combines elements of jazz, progressive rock, psychedelic, fusion, and electronica into its instrumental tunes. The group is back with a new single, “The First Utopian,” from its Unplugged recording session at the end of December 2023.
Earlier this year, the band released a live stripped-back version of another track, “Moon Dust.” The recording session intended to get the four musicians in one room and record spontaneous takes of old songs, with each of them being fully immersed in the moment. You could call these tracks moments of Zen.
“The First Utopian” was originally released in 2022 on Cone of Confusion’s sophomore album, Hominid. Recorded live at Studios 301 in Sydney, the new acoustic rendition offers a stripped-back arrangement of the original composition and captures the essence of the group’s musical camaraderie. The clean arrangements and organic instrumentation provide a fresh perspective on the song and hint at Cone of Confusion’s new musical vision.
Composed by Rémi Marchand, “The First Utopian (Unplugged)” features Jack Garzonio on piano instead of his usual synthesizers, organ, and synth bass. Rémi plays the intro and outro on his childhood nylon string guitar to bring a softer touch than what would’ve been possible with an electric guitar.
For the rest of the composition, Chris Blundell (tenor saxophone) and Rémi avoided their characteristic use of effect pedals, letting the song’s structure shine in its purest and most unadulterated form. Juan Carlos Negrete plays the drums with a gentle and soothing touch of brushes. Additionally, the artwork for the single was meticulously crafted by Rémi, adding visual depth to the auditory journey.
